This is from a chilly night back in early December. We're looking southeast from Buffalo Point on Antelope Island. I took multiple shots and combined a couple so the dark foreground would show a little detail. We've been watching an Idaho geology professor on YouTube (Shawn Willsey if anyone's interested) who explained the rock layers here. The Farmington Complex is the lower layer and goes back 1.8 billion years! The layer above that was deposited at a time when the Earth was covered in glaciers. It was slightly warmer that night. :)
